"I'm not sure the framework you have of making this a special feature worked that well. Many times, "lost movie scenes" type sketches take place as clips on a talk show."

I suspect Jason was trying to duplicate the Special Features menu from the "Rain Man" DVD. There's only one deleted scene, and it's introduced by Barry Levinson before it plays. When the scene ends, the disc returns us to the menu. Used in a sketch, I think it needs to return to Levinson for a final punchline, instead of just fading to black as it does on the DVD. Kind of like when Tom Hanks showed outtakes from "Big" years ago, or the "Titanic" lost ending that segued to James Cameron lighting his cigar with a $100 bill before fading to commercial. But I did like the Jarrett's Room style of duplicating the DVD menu screen for the sketch, as well as the absurdity of playing for a new bathroom set.
